1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does ASA stand for in triangle congruence?
Back
Angle-Side-Angle: A method to prove triangles are congruent by showing two angles and the included side are equal.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does SAS stand for in triangle congruence?
Back
Side-Angle-Side: A method to prove triangles are congruent by showing two sides and the included angle are equal.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does AAS stand for in triangle congruence?
Back
Angle-Angle-Side: A method to prove triangles are congruent by showing two angles and a non-included side are equal.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does SSS stand for in triangle congruence?
Back
Side-Side-Side: A method to prove triangles are congruent by showing all three sides are equal.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the HL theorem in triangle congruence?
Back
Hypotenuse-Leg: A method to prove right triangles are congruent by showing the hypotenuse and one leg are equal.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How can you determine if two triangles are congruent using the ASA method?
Back
If two angles and the included side of one triangle are equal to two angles and the included side of another triangle, they are congruent.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the significance of the SSA condition in triangle congruence?
Back
SSA does not guarantee triangle congruence; it can lead to ambiguous cases.
